Abstract
Finite Element analysis of a high-voltage potentiometer used in a Televisio n set is presented. The net field is a result of coupling between the curre nt fields and the electric fields. Techniques for optimization using SWIFT non-linear programming method are developed to solve for shape of the semi- conductive layer in the potentiometer to even out the field strength distri butions and reduce the risk of discharge fault.
